I started with a blackberry, then used a Palm and now the HTC. If I was to choose one after using all three, I'd choose the armour coated Palm. (Has a heavy black rubber coating for protection). Be careful with the HTC and the web browser. You have to go to Programs, memory and running programs to turn the stuff off or it just continues. I ended up purchasing a unlimited web browsing account as the browser is constantly hooked up. I have more challenges with 'no zone' effects with this phone than the others.
